> IOW, you want the user-defined type to declare that it's an input
> range, and not just some random struct that happens to have input
> range like functions?
>
Yes.
> What about modifying isInputRange to be something like this:
>
> template isInputRange(R) {
> static if (R.implementsInputRange &&
> /* ... check for input range properties here
> */) {
> enum isInputRange = true;
> } else {
> enum isInputRange = false;
> }
> }
>
> Then all input ranges will have to explicitly declare they are an
> input range thus:
>
> struct MyInpRange {
> // This asserts that we're trying to be an input range
> enum implementsInputRange = true;
>
> // ... define .empty, .front, .popFront here
> }
>
Close. At that point you need two steps:
struct MyInpRange {
// Declare this as an input range
enum implementsInputRange = true;
// Enforce this really *IS* as an input range
static assert(isInputRange!MyRange,
"Dude, your struct isn't a range!"); // asserts
// ... define .empty, .front, .popFront here
}
My suggestion was to take basically that, and then wrap up the "Declare
and Enfore" in one simple step:
struct MyInpRange {
// Generate & mixin *both* the "enum" and the "static assert"
mixin(implements!InputRange);
// ... define .empty, .front, .popFront here
}
/Dreaming:
Of course, it'd be even nicer still to have all this wrapped up in
some language sugar (D3? ;) ) and just do something like:
struct interface InputRange {
// ... *declare* .empty, .front, .popFront here
}
struct interface ForwardRange : InputRange {
// ... *declare* .save here
}
struct MyForwardRange : ForwardRange {
// ... define .empty, .front, .popFront, .save here
// Actually validated by the compiler
}
Which would then amount to what we're doing by hand up above. So kinda
